Family Services Program:
Norfolk Family Services Office
Goldenrod Hills Community Action
1405 Riverside Blvd
Norfolk, NE 68701
(402) 371-0377
Counties Served: Madison
Hours: M-F 8:00 a.m-4:30 p.m. (appointments preferred)
The Norfolk office provides FEMA services (rent and utility vouchers), Tax Counseling, Food pantry, Migrant funds, Child Car Seat Program, Case Management, Homeless/Preventative Homeless Program, and Family Development Case Management.

| Head Start Program:
Norfolk Head Start:
Address: 301 East Omaha Avenue, Norfolk, NE
Mailing Address: P.O. Box 2087, Norfolk, NE 68702
Phone Number: (402) 371-8030
Fax Number: (402) 371-7703
Norfolk Head Start has four classrooms with 19 children in each room. We
serve 76 families. Each class has three education staff members and
bilingual staff members available. Three morning classes and one
afternoon class are in session four hours a day, Monday through Friday.
We have one full-year classroom that runs 12 months. The other three
classrooms are in session September through May. Preschool services are
free to families that qualify based on their income. In addition to the
four classrooms, Norfolk has three family service workers who are
available to work with parents and make referrals as needed.
The Norfolk Head Start is also the site of the Goldenrod Hills Head Start Training Classroom, which offers training to all new Head Start employees. New employees are able to spend time in the Norfolk center to receive the required training before beginning any new position within the Head Start programs.
